Is it possible to configure Darwinia to tell it which sound device to use? For some reason, it is insisting on using the USB Voip phone sound adaptor instead of my SoundBlaster X-Fi device, leading to predictably poor performance!

I have checked that the default sound device selected under Control Panel\Sounds and AudioDevices\Sound playback is "SB X-Fi Audio", and have tried switching that to "PHILIPS VOIP123" and back again, it makes no difference. As far as I can tell, no other software has any trouble recognizing that as the correct audio default device to use.

If I disable the Voip sound device, then Darwinia uses the SoundBlaster device, and performance is fine. Re-enabling the Voip sound device causes Darwinia to again use it in preference to the SoundBlaster.

Is there any way of forcing Darwinia to use a specified sound device, or getting it to obey the Windows Default sound device?
